Transaction fb83db2579d1294680630d86bfb5088a32aed81720dd4552ff4719a2aef656b9
1 Input
1 Output
-
fb83db2579d1294680630d86bfb5088a32aed81720dd4552ff4719a2aef656b9:0
- value
- 16073453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dec2a050907f5d557d4d6e1cbb987cc51347d2e OP_EQUAL
- address
- MHvNoK34LpzDt9Vmn41c5H62KYWuRLMz7x